Our process for resolving disputes around payment will begin with an investigation of why a payment has not been made. If it is due to a process error within the group or lack of correct payee information it will be rectified and payment made as soon as possible. Resolution of all other disputes will start with the business owner for the expenditure – who will hold discussions with the vendor in order to work through any disagreement. If an agreement cannot be reached, then the dispute will be escalated through the Group to a member of senior management who are expected to reach a mutually acceptable resolution. If this does not work then the dispute will ultimately be escalated to the Group Finance Director for resolution.

Does this business offer supply chain finance?
This is where a supplier who has submitted an invoice can be paid by a third-party finance provider earlier than the agreed payment date. The business would then pay the finance provider the invoiced sum.
